[strongSwan] Strongswan Performance (IKEv1 tunnel establishment rate)

Martin Willi martin at strongswan.org
Thu Nov 17 10:01:49 CET 2011

Hi Amit,

> Thanks for your reply. I am more interested in IKEv1 performance.
> Please share if you have any performance numbers for IKEv1.

No, I haven't done any performance measurement for IKEv1.

> From figures you have mentioned  (  > 10'000 tunnels in couple of
> minutes) at the max 83 tunnels can be established in one second.  Has
> anyone done IKEv2 strongswan performance characterization? What is the
> max number of tunnels established in a second?  

This highly depends on your hardware and the used public key operations,
as this is usually the limiting factor. If you have a high-end system
and use elliptic curve cryptography, you can get 500 or even more
complete tunnel setups per second. Our IKEv2 daemon has been tested to
scale almost linearly to up to 16 cores if configured properly.


